EXCEEDS logo
Exceeds
Sophia Hanley

PROFILE

Sophia Hanley

Worked on the chronosphereio/terraform-provider-chronosphere repository, delivering four features over four months focused on observability and log management. Developed logging support for monitor queries, migrated the Log Allocation API to a stable version, and introduced a Log Control Rules resource to enable consistent log governance through infrastructure-as-code. Enhanced the provider with metrics emission, field replacement, and field normalization options, improving telemetry and data processing. Leveraged Go, Terraform, and HCL to update schemas, models, and client configurations, emphasizing maintainability and integration. The work enabled more actionable observability, reduced log volume, and streamlined configuration for Terraform-managed Chronosphere environments.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

4Total
Bugs
0
Commits
4
Features
4
Lines of code
6,422
Activity Months4

Work History

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025: Key feature delivery in the Chronosphere Terraform provider focusing on metrics emission, field replacement, and field normalization enhancements. Implemented new options emit_metrics and replace_fields for log control and improved log ingest with field_normalization, enabling richer telemetry and more consistent data processing. These changes reduce configuration complexity, improve observability, and support stronger customer outcomes across Terraform-managed deployments.

August 2025

1 Commits • 1 Features

Aug 1, 2025

August 2025 monthly summary: Focused on delivering observable business value through infrastructure-as-code enhancements in the Chronosphere Terraform provider. Key feature delivered: Log Control Rules Resource enabling configuration of log control rules (drop, sampling, or dropping fields) with filters and modes. Introduced new enum types for rule modes and rule types and integrated the resource into the provider. This work is tracked under commit 00be6e4c352a8c5083ec1190fd4c397f31eefa46 ("add log control config (#147)"). Major bugs fixed: none reported this month. Overall impact: empowers consistent log governance across environments, reduces noisy/log volume, and improves automation and repeatability of deployments. Technologies/skills demonstrated: Terraform provider development, resource modeling, enum design, provider integration, and disciplined code review."

February 2025

1 Commits • 1 Features

Feb 1, 2025

February 2025: Delivered migration of the Log Allocation API from unstable to stable v1 within the chronosphere Terraform provider (chronosphereio/terraform-provider-chronosphere). Updated generated Go files, client configurations, and models to reflect the API version change while preserving core functionality. This reduces maintenance burden and provides a stable, predictable API surface for downstream users.

January 2025

1 Commits • 1 Features

Jan 1, 2025

Concise monthly summary for 2025-01 highlighting key feature delivery, impact, and technical skills demonstrated for the chronosphere Terraform provider work.

Activity

Loading activity data...

Quality Metrics

Correctness97.6%
Maintainability97.6%
Architecture97.6%
Performance90.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

GoHCLMarkdownTerraform

Technical Skills

API IntegrationAPI MigrationData ProcessingGoGo ProgrammingLog ManagementLoggingMetricsObservabilityRefactoringTerraformTerraform Provider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

chronosphereio/terraform-provider-chronosphere

Jan 2025 Oct 2025
4 Months active

Languages Used

GoTerraformMarkdownHCL

Technical Skills

Go ProgrammingLoggingObservabilityTerraform Provider DevelopmentAPI MigrationGo